Cons
Definitely think twice before taking on the “field sales” role. There are people who have been working here for more than a year who still don’t have sick days or a basic benefits package. As a field sales rep, your every move will be hawkishly watched for fear you may over-bill. you will be micro managed at every level. Meanwhile. your salaried colleagues (who all hold equity in the company btw) work from home while enjoying their 20 days paid vacation and $1000+ technology stipend. Simply put, you are a second class citizen who can be fired at a moments notice with no warning, severance or recourse. Generally speaking, this culture consists of pretending that the roof isn’t on fire while the company continues to haemorrhage money with no visible end in sight. Take a look at all of the reviews, not much has changed over the years. The company has been lapped by its competitors so many times that it’s no longer an actual competition. If you come here understand from day 1 that this is merely a stepping stone, don’t hesitate to leave the second a better opportunity presents itself.
